Tomorrow afternoon, some of the members of Red Leicester will be leading the Christmas carols at LOROS Hospice’s annual Light Up a Life service. The service begins at 4.30pm on Sunday the 7th of December, and takes place in the hospice grounds. In addition to the carols, the Christmas tree lights are switched on, and visitors are encouraged to remember the lives of their loved ones. More details can be found here.
